Written by 妖怪April 26, 2021 3.2 Billion Leaked Passwords Contain 1.5 Million Records with Government Emails https://thehackernews.com/2021/04/32-billion-leaked-passwords-contain-15.htmlShare this: Share on X (Opens in new window) X Share on Facebook (Opens in new window) Facebook Like this:Like Loading...